Highlights of this title
Endesa is an energy company involved in the generation, distribution, and supply of electricity. In addition, the company holds interests in other businesses such as renewable energies and cogeneration, distribution, and supply of natural gas.
The company recorded revenues of E20,580 million during the fiscal 2006, an increase of 12.9% over 2005. The companys revenues have recorded a CAGR of 5% during the period 2002-2006.
As on December 31, 2006, Endesa had a total installed capacity of 47,113 megawatts (MW), and in 2006, the company generated 186,411 gigawatt hours (GWh) of electricity and sold 220,299 GWh, supplying electricity to approximately 22.7 million customers in 15 countries.
